Description

I Danced with a Mosquito is one of the highly evocative orchestral Eight Russian Folksongs written by the Russian composer Anatoly Liadov in 1906. Liadov’s humorous score for this short, pastoral song sets a tuneful bird-like melody for flutes and piccolo against buzzing, capricious strings.

This arrangement was made for the Fontanella Recorder Quintet in 2019 and first performed for the Worcester Early Music Festival that year.
